What Is Duggar Tater Tot Casserole?
Duggar tater tot casserole is a layered dish made with seasoned ground beef, cream soups, and tater tots baked to golden perfection. It’s a budget-friendly and comforting meal that’s become a family favorite.

Duggar Tater Tot Casserole Ingredients
- Ground beef: 1½ lbs
- Onion: 1 medium, diced
- Cream of mushroom soup: 1 can (10.5 oz)
- Cream of chicken soup: 1 can (10.5 oz)
- Milk: 1 cup
- Frozen tater tots: 1 bag (32 oz)
- Cheddar cheese: 1 cup, shredded (optional)
- Salt and pepper: To taste
- Vegetable oil: 1 tablespoon (optional, for sautéing)
Step-by-Step Instructions to Prepare Duggar Tater Tot Casserole
Cook the Ground Beef
- In a large skillet, heat vegetable oil over medium heat (if needed). Add the ground beef and diced onion. Cook until the beef is browned and the onion is soft. Season with salt and pepper. Drain any excess grease.
Prepare the Sauce
- In a mixing bowl, combine the cream of mushroom soup, cream of chicken soup, and milk. Stir until smooth.
Assemble the Casserole
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ish.
- Spread the cooked ground beef and onion mixture evenly over the bottom of the dish.
- Pour the soup mixture over the beef layer, spreading it out evenly.
- Arrange the frozen tater tots in a single layer on top of the sauce.
Bake the Casserole
- Bake in the preheated oven for 35-40 minutes, or until the tater tots are golden brown and crispy.
Add Cheese (Optional)
- If desired, sprinkle shredded cheddar cheese over the tater tots during the last 5 minutes of baking. Allow it to melt before serving.

Expert Tips for Perfect Tater Tot Casserole
- Use lean ground beef: Reduces excess grease and makes the dish less heavy.
- Keep the tots crispy: Bake uncovered to achieve a golden, crispy topping.
- Customize the layers: Add canned green beans, corn, or cooked bacon for extra flavor.
- Season to taste: Adjust salt and pepper to suit your preferences.
- Let it cool slightly: Allow the casserole to rest for 5 minutes before serving to set the layers.
Variations of Duggar Tater Tot Casserole
- Mexican-style: Add taco seasoning to the beef and top with salsa and jalapeños.
- Breakfast version: Use sausage instead of beef and include scrambled eggs.
- Vegetarian: Substitute the beef with plant-based crumbles or cooked lentils.
- Cheesier: Add a layer of cheese between the beef and the soup mixture.
- Spicy kick: Mix hot sauce or cayenne pepper into the soup mixture.
How to Store Duggar Tater Tot Casserole Leftovers
- Refrigerate: Place leftovers in an airtight container and refrigerate for up to 3 days.
- Freeze: Store in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months. Thaw in the refrigerator overnight before reheating.
How to Reheat Duggar Tater Tot Casserole Leftovers
- Oven: Reheat at 350°F for 15-20 minutes until warmed through.
- Microwave: Heat individual portions on high for 1-2 minutes.
- Air fryer: Crisp up the tater tots by reheating in an air fryer at 375°F for 5-7 minutes.

FAQs
Can I use different soups in Duggar tater tot casserole?
Yes, you can customize the casserole by using other creamy soups like cream of celery or cheddar cheese soup. Mixing two different soups adds more depth of flavor.
How do I keep the tater tots crispy in the casserole?
To keep tater tots crispy, bake the casserole uncovered, ensuring the hot air circulates around the tots. Avoid adding too much liquid to the sauce, as it can make the topping soggy.
Can I make Duggar tater tot casserole ahead of time?
Yes, you can assemble the casserole up to a day in advance. Cover and refrigerate it, then bake just before serving. Add 5-10 extra minutes to the baking time if starting from cold.
What vegetables can I add to the Duggar tater tot casserole?
Popular vegetables to add include green beans, corn, peas, or diced carrots. Layer the vegetables over the cooked ground beef before adding the soup mixture and tater tots.
